Assessment Details

Cambridge IGCSE assessment takes place at the end of the course. It comprises of different types of assessment including written, oral, coursework and practical assessment.

  • Questioning, classroom activities & discussions, learning tasks, coursework, oral, practical & written assessments (Unit Tests / Periodic Assessments)– Internal
  • IGCSE - International General Certificate of Secondary Education – External
  • ICE - Cambridge International Certificate in Education– External
